Hulu will serve up Season 2 of “The Bear” on June 22!
Starring Jeremy Allen White as Carmen “Carmy” Berzatto, “The Bear” follows a young, classically trained chef who returns home to Chicago to run his family’s Italian beef shop after his brother dies by suicide. The series also stars Ayo Edebiri, Ebon Moss-Bachrach, Lionel Boyce, Liza Colón-Zayas, Edwin Lee Gibson, Abby Elliott, Corey Hendrix, Matty Matheson, Richard Esteras and Jose M. Cervantes.
Bob Odenkirk is joining the show in a guest starring capacity. Molly Gordon has also boarded the series in a key recurring role.
Created by Christopher Storer, “The Bear” Season 2 will be 10 episodes long, two more than the first, and will focus on the new restaurant’s opening.
After its debut, “The Bear” became FX’s most-watched half-hour series and scored trophies from the Screen Actors, Writers and Producers Guild Awards. Additionally, White won the Golden Globe for best actor in a TV series, musical or comedy.
Season 1 of “The Bear” is available to stream on Hulu.
